#096494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#096494 is composed of 3.5% red, 39.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 32.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 200.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 30.8%. #096494 color hex could be obtained by blending #12c8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#096494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#096494 has RGB values of R:9, G:100,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 615572.

Shades and Tints of #096494
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#096494
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4f52 is the less saturated color, while #03669a is the most saturated one.
